Climbing Chimborazo 1986

Alpinism? Climbing?

I am not sure. Whilst cycling from Chile to Alaska I decided to climb the volcano Chimborazo. 1986. 6310 meters back then, today 6263 metres. I had no money, no gear. So I hired two half crampons, the old rough edged ones, used mums knitted gloves and sweater. It was cold and windy. Most amazing of all, I climbed in tennis shoes. Nowadays people think they need the best gear to do things. What to say….the name of my guide was the legendary Enrique Veloz.
